TBILISI, July 31 (AVN) - The Georgian Tbilaviastroi aircraft enterprise will take part in the MAKS 2001aircraft show that is to open on August 14, Gocha Goguadze, chief engineer of the enterprise, told the Military News Agency on Tuesday.
The enterprise received an invitation after the successful demonstration of the SU-25 Frogfoot mass production attack plane modernised together with the Elbit Systems Ltd company of Israel at the Le Bourget show in June. The modernised SU-25 plane has sophisticated radio electronic equipment allowing to use it day and night and in the most difficult weather conditions.
According to Goguadze, Russian colleagues from the Sukhoi design bureau are to show the Georgin producers their modernisation variant of the SU-25 plane which will be exhibited at the MAKS 2001 show. Officials of both enterprises are discussing possibility of establishment of a joint enterprise for modernisation of the SU series attack planes.
